4 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Squeaker'
The engineering team celebrated after the successful launch of the rocket, which had been a real squeaker during the testing phase.
The scientific experiment turned into a squeaker when an unexpected variable almost derailed the entire process.
The chess grandmaster faced a squeaker as the opponent unexpectedly made a brilliant move, threatening checkmate.
The software development project turned into a squeaker when a critical bug was discovered just before the product launch.
